===March=== {{Main|March 1940}} *[[March 5]] β [[Katyn massacre]]: Members of the Soviet Politburo ([[Joseph Stalin]], [[Vyacheslav Molotov]], [[Lazar Kaganovich]], [[Mikhail Kalinin]], [[Kliment Voroshilov]] and [[Lavrentiy Beria]]) sign an order, prepared by Beria, for the execution of 25,700 Polish intelligentsia, including 14,700 Polish POWs. *[[March 11]] β [[Ed Ricketts]], [[John Steinbeck]] and six others leave [[Monterey, California]], United States, for the [[Gulf of California]], on a marine invertebrate collecting expedition. *[[March 12]] β [[Moscow Peace Treaty]]: The [[Soviet Union]] and Finland sign a peace treaty in Moscow, ending the [[Winter War]]; Finns, along with the world at large, are shocked by the harsh terms. *[[March 13]] β Indian nationalist [[Udham Singh]] assassinates Sir [[Michael O'Dwyer]] (in revenge for the [[1919]] [[Jallianwala Bagh massacre]]) at [[Caxton Hall]] in [[London]], for which he is hanged on 31 July at [[HM Prison Pentonville]]. *[[March 18]] β WWII: [[Axis powers]] β [[Adolf Hitler]] and [[Benito Mussolini]] meet at [[Brenner Pass]] in the [[Alps]]. After being informed by Hitler that the Germans are ready to attack in the west, Mussolini agrees to bring Italy into the war in due course.<ref>{{cite book |last=Burgwyn |first=H |title=Italian foreign policy in the interwar period, 1918-1940 |publisher=Praeger |location=Westport, Conn |year=1997 |isbn=9780275948771 |page=211}}</ref> *[[March 21]] β [[Γdouard Daladier]] resigns as Prime Minister of France; [[Paul Reynaud]] succeeds him. *[[March 23]] β [[Pakistan Movement]]: The [[Lahore Resolution]], calling for greater autonomy for what will become [[Pakistan]] in [[British India]], is drawn up by the [[All-India Muslim League]] during a three-day general session at [[Iqbal Park]], [[Lahore]]. *[[March 30]] β WWII: Former [[Kuomintang]] member and Chinese foreign minister, [[Wang Jingwei]], announces the creation of the [[Reorganized National Government of the Republic of China]] in [[Nanjing]]. *[[March 31]] β WWII: [[Commerce raiding]] {{Ship|German auxiliary cruiser|Atlantis}} leaves the [[Wadden Sea]] for what will become the longest warship cruise of the war (622 days without in-port replenishment or repair).<ref>{{cite book |author=Muggenthaler, August Karl |title=German Raiders of WWII |publisher=Prentice-Hall |year=1977 |isbn=978-0-13-354027-7 |page=14}}</ref>
